Betty was born on May 25, 1943 in Providence, RI to Russell and Rubina Ferri.
Betty’s career passion was to become a Registered Nurse. She fulfilled that passion by receiving her RN degree from SUNY at Dutchess, Poughkeepsie, NY. She continued with her education receiving her BA and MBA in Healthcare Administration from New School, NY City.
Betty worked her way through the nursing ranks to the top of her field, Chief Nursing Officer, a position she proudly held at four hospitals, lastly being Healthfirst’s Holmes Regional Medical Center and Palm Bay Hospital. After retiring from Healthfirst Betty began medical consulting with B.E. Smith consulting in Lenexa, KS. Following her consulting she joined the startup team for the new Kindred Hospital, Melbourne as director of Quality Management and Infection Control. Betty finally retired for the last time in 2012.
On November 10, 1993, Betty married Ben Herrman. They made their home in New Brunswick and Waretown, NJ before moving to Melbourne, FL in May 1999 where her career started with HealthFirst.
Betty was preceded in death by her parents, Russell and Rubina Ferri; Brother, Robert Ferri and Sister, Joyce Ferri.
Betty is survived by her husband and soulmate, Ben of Rockledge; Two daughters, Carla Manco of Mitchell, SD and Joyce Green, Melbourne, FL; Two step sons, David Herrman, Merritt Island, FL, Scott Herrman, Voorhees, NJ; her brother Russell Ferri, Cranston, RI; six grandsons, one granddaughter, one great granddaughter, two nieces, one nephew and a number of cousins.
She loved her family first and foremost. She was an avid traveler, cruising worldwide, loved country music and dancing with her husband Ben, playing golf, gambling in general and spending time with her friends who she considered her extended family.
Betty was a great believer in helping children and our veterans.
